FTM Flat Tire Monitor The conceptThe system does not measure the actual infla‐
tion pressure in the tires.
It detects a pressure loss in a tire by comparing
the rotational speeds of the individual wheels
while moving.
In the event of a pressure loss, the diameter
and therefore the rotational speed of the corre‐
sponding wheel change. This is detected and
reported as a flat tire.
Functional requirements
The system must have been initialized when
the tire inflation pressure was correct; other‐
wise, reliable signaling of a flat tire is not en‐
sured. Initialize the system after each correc‐
tion of the tire inflation pressure and after
every tire or wheel change.
System limits Sudden tire damage
Sudden serious tire damage caused by
external influences cannot be indicated in ad‐
vance.◀
A natural, even pressure loss in all four tires
cannot be detected. Therefore, check the tire
inflation pressure regularly.
The system could be delayed or malfunction in
the following situations:▷When the system has not been initialized.▷When driving on a snowy or slippery road
surface.▷Sporty driving style: slip in the drive
wheels, high lateral acceleration.▷When driving with snow chains.

Tire Pressure Monitor TPMThe concept
The tire inflation pressure is measured in the
four mounted tires. The system notifies you if
there is a significant loss of pressure in one or
more tires.
Functional requirements The system must have been reset while the in‐
flation pressure was correct; otherwise, reliable
signaling of a flat tire is not ensured.
Always use wheels with TPM electronics to
ensure that the system will operate properly.
Reset the system after each correction of the
tire inflation pressure and after every tire or
wheel change.
System limits Sudden tire damage
Sudden serious tire damage caused by
external influences cannot be indicated in ad‐
vance.◀
The system does not operate correctly if it has
not been reset. For example, a flat tire may be
indicated despite correct tire inflation pres‐
sures.
The system is inactive and cannot indicate a
flat tire:▷For a mounted wheel without TPM elec‐
tronics.▷When the TPM is disturbed by other sys‐
tems or devices with the same radio fre‐
quency.Status display1."Vehicle Info"2."Vehicle status"3. "TPM"

Declaration according to NHTSA/
FMVSS 138 Tire Pressure Monitoring
Systems
Each tire, including the spare (if provided)
should be checked monthly when cold and in‐
flated to the inflation pressure recommended
by the vehicle manufacturer on the vehicle
placard or tire inflation pressure label (If your
vehicle has tires of a different size than the size
indicated on the vehicle placard or tire inflation
pressure label, you should determine the
proper tire inflation pressure for those tires.).
As an added safety feature, your vehicle has
been equipped with a tire pressure monitoring
system (TPMS) that illuminates a low tire pres‐
sure telltale when one or more of your tires is
significantly under-inflated. Accordingly, when
the low tire pressure telltale illuminates, you
should stop and check your tires as soon as
possible, and inflate them to the proper pres‐
sure. Driving on a significantly under-inflated
tire causes the tire to overheat and can lead to
tire failure. Under-inflation also reduces fuel ef‐
Seite 95SafetyControls95
Online Edition for Part no. 01 40 2 911 269 - VI/13
Page 100 of 299
ficiency and tire tread life, and may affect the
vehicle's handling and stopping ability.
Please note that the TPMS is not a substitute
for proper tire maintenance, and it is the driv‐
er's responsibility to maintain correct tire pres‐
sure, even if under-inflation has not reached
the level to trigger illumination of the TPMS
low tire pressure telltale.
Your vehicle has also been equipped with a
TPMS malfunction indicator to indicate when
the system is not operating properly. The
TPMS malfunction indicator is combined with
the low tire pressure telltale. When the system
detects a malfunction, the telltale will flash for
approximately one minute and then remain
continuously illuminated. This sequence will
continue upon subsequent vehicle startups as
long as the malfunction exists. When the mal‐
function indicator is illuminated, the system
may not be able to detect or signal low tire
pressure as intended. TPMS malfunctions may
occur for a variety of reasons, including the in‐
stallation of replacement or alternate tires or
wheels on the vehicle that prevent the TPMS
from functioning properly. Always check the
TPMS malfunction telltale after replacing one
or more tires or wheels on your vehicle to en‐
sure that the replacement or alternate tires and
wheels allow the TPMS to continue to function
properly.Brake force display

Breaking-in period
General information Moving parts need to be broken in to adjust to
each other.
The following instructions will help achieve a
long vehicle life and good economy.
Engine and differential Always obey all official speed limits.
Up to 1,200 miles/2,000 km
Do not exceed the maximum engine and road
speeds:▷4,500 rpm and 100 mph/160 km/h.
Avoid full-throttle operation and use of the
transmission's kickdown mode for the initial
miles.
From 1,200 miles/2,000 km The engine and vehicle speed can gradually be
increased.
Tires
Due to technical factors associated with their
manufacture, tires do not achieve their full
traction potential until after an initial breaking-
in period.
Drive conservatively for the first
200 miles/300 km.
Brake system
Brakes require an initial break-in period of ap‐
prox. 300 miles/500 km to achieve optimized
contact and wear patterns between brake pads and discs. Drive cautiously during this break-in
period.
Following part replacement
The same breaking in procedures should be
observed if any of the components mentioned
above have to be renewed in the course of the
vehicle's operating life.

Hydroplaning On wet or slushy roads, a wedge of water can
form between the tires and road surface.
This phenomenon is referred to as hydroplan‐
ing. It is characterized by a partial or complete loss of contact between the tires and the road
surface, ultimately undermining your ability to
steer and brake the vehicle.
Hydroplaning
When driving on wet or slushy roads, re‐
duce your speed to prevent hydroplaning.◀
The risk of hydroplaning increases as the tire
tread depth decreases. Minimum tread depth,
refer to page 238.Driving through water
Drive though calm water only if it is not deeper
than 12 inches/30 cm and at this height, no
faster than walking speed, up to
6 mph/10 km/h.
Adhere to water depth and speed limita‐
tions
Do not exceed this water depth and walking speed; otherwise, the vehicle's engine, the
electrical systems and the transmission may
be damaged.◀
Braking safely
Your vehicle is equipped with ABS as a stand‐
ard feature.
Applying the brakes fully is the most effective
way of braking in situations when this is neces‐
sary.
The vehicle maintains steering responsive‐
ness. You can still avoid any obstacles with a
minimum of steering effort.
Pulsation of the brake pedal and sounds from
the hydraulic circuits indicate that ABS is in its
active mode.
Do not let your foot rest on the brake
pedal
Do not drive with your foot resting on the brake
pedal. Even light but consistent pedal pressure
can lead to high temperatures, brake wear and
possibly even brake failure.◀
